When you meet someone for the first time in japan, you should know how to greet them . So, these are the basic and formal Greeting and conversation in Japanese. Have fun learning !


Dialog 1:


はじめまして。
HAJIMEMASHITE.
    How do you do?

私はhudaです。
WATASHI WA HUDA DESU.
I’m Huda.

マレーシアから来きました。
MARESHIA KARA KIMASHITA.
I’m from Malaysia.

よろしくお願ねがいします。
YOROSHIKU ONEGAI SHIMASU.
Nice to meet you.



GRAMMAR POINT
When you introduce yourself, you say Watashi wa ____ desu. This means “I am _____.”
 To use the past tense, change ––masu form of a verb to ––mashita
              Ex. kimasu (come) → kimashita (came), ikimasu (go) → ikimashita (went)


you also can add other's greeting such good morning to them.
Here are the example of other's Greeting :

when you want to say Good Morning :

おはようございます
OHAYÔ GOZAIMASU


when you want to say Good Afternoon:

こんにちは
KONNICHIWA


when you want to say Good Evening:

こんばんは
KONBANWA


And when you want to say GoodBye says:

さようなら
SAYÔNARA
